What is a Power System Study Engineer job?

A Power System Study Engineer is responsible for analyzing and evaluating electrical power systems to ensure their reliability, efficiency, and stability. They conduct studies on load flow, short circuits, arc flash, transient stability, and protection coordination using specialized software. Their work helps in designing and optimizing power grids, integrating renewable energy sources, and ensuring compliance with industry standards. They collaborate with utilities, industries, and engineering firms to solve complex power system challenges. Strong analytical skills and knowledge of electrical engineering principles are required for this role.

What are the key skills and qualifications needed to thrive in the Power System Study Engineer position, and why are they important?

To thrive as a Power System Study Engineer, you should have a strong background in electrical engineering with expertise in power systems analysis, typically supported by a relevant degree. Proficiency in industry-standard software such as PSS®E, ETAP, or DIgSILENT PowerFactory and familiarity with grid codes and standards are essential. Excellent problem-solving, communication, and teamwork skills help you effectively address complex technical scenarios and present findings to diverse stakeholders. These skills and qualities are critical for delivering reliable, safe, and efficient power system designs and analyses in both utility and consulting environments.
